    Page Rank Prediction is completly meaningless.

    I get a kick out of the fools trying to do link exchanges, link sales, or selling sites and claiming the predicted PR is 3, or 4, or 5, or whatever. If your trying to use predicted PR to inflate the value of a site then you might as well be saying that it is PR0.

    If you want to know predicted PR, just so you know what it might be for your own site, then you are just wasting your time that could be spent getting more links. Just wait till next google update and your PR will be whatever goog deems it to be. If you want it to be higher then just buy a link on a PR(desired PR+1) site.

    One of my sites has been a PR4 for about a year, but on last update it dropped to PR0. Why? I have no idea. i know there are plenty of PR4 links to it and a few PR5 links as well. Must be a glitch or something at goog. But my SERP rankings have not been affected, so i dont really care.
